async function checkToken(token) {
const result = await superagent
.post(`${config.serviceUrl}/check_token`)
.send({token});
return result.body;
}
Default options if this call will return 401 throws an Exception, which is not what i expect. API i call is using HTTP status messages also as body to give information back and i just need the body part.
Response with http status 401 is
{
"data": null,
"error": {
"code": "INVALID_TOKEN",
"message": "Token is not valid"
}
}
And currently, to get this, I need to wrap all superagent calls with try...catch
async function checkToken(token) {
let result = null;
try {
result = await superagent
.post(`${config.serviceUrl}/check_token`)
.send({token});
} catch (e) {
result = e.response;
}
return result.body;
}
Any way to have the 1st sample working and returning JSON w/o looking at HTTP status?
Superagent by default treats every 4xx and 5xx response as error. You can however tell it, which responses you consider as error, by using .ok.
Sample example from documentation (https://visionmedia.github.io/superagent/#error-handling),
request.get('/404')
.ok(res => res.status < 500)
.then(response => {
// reads 404 page as a successful response
})
If the function inside the .ok, returns true then it will not be considered as error case.
